I know what you are thinking but I need some help!
I currently use a halfords special 5 LED 3 Lux light which is okay, it's fairly bright and up to a couple of weeks ago I was happy with it.
Then I saw my Nemsis (the guy I see twice a day, every day who never acknowledges me) and I notice that he has got a new light and it is seriously bright. It's so bright that I thought he was a motorbike at first.
Now that's got to be good for getting noticed, hasn't it?
But looking into it there are so many different options that my head hurts
My preference is for a all in one unit such as a Maxx D - Daddy, not sure why but having a seperate battery pack just seems messy. Are there any advantages to this set up?
I am also unsure as to how many lumens I should go for, my ride is predominately on street lit roads although in 2 places most of the lights don't work and the trees obscur most of the light anyway!!
So currently I am thinking of a Exposure Strada £210 - 480 Lumens or a Hope 1 Vision which is £75 and 240 Lumens.
I have also looked at Ay Up's and the Magic Shine but have been put off by the sperate battery pack.
So I guess my question is how many lumens do I *really* need or is it a case of you can never have too many andf*** nevermind the drivers retinas?
